AEye executives outlined the company’s strategy to expand its software-defined LiDAR technology across automotive, defense, security and other “physical AI” applications, emphasizing long-range sensing, manufacturing flexibility and a capital-light business model during a J.P. Morgan conference presentation.

Matt Fisch, chairman and chief executive officer of Audioeye NASDAQ: AEYE, said LiDAR remains an important component of autonomous-driving sensor stacks alongside radar and cameras. He said LiDAR can provide long-range sensing with greater resolution than radar and can operate in conditions including direct sunlight and rain.

Fisch said the market’s view of automotive LiDAR has shifted away from a “monolithic” approach, in which one sensor performs multiple tasks across a vehicle. Instead, automakers are increasingly considering specialized sensor configurations for different vehicle functions, he said.

Flexible sensor architecture

AEye’s approach centers on what Fisch described as software-defined LiDAR, allowing customers to allocate a sensor’s “photon budget” differently depending on an application. For example, the company can prioritize long-distance sensing, higher frame rates, resolution or wider fields of view without requiring a wholesale hardware redesign, according to Fisch.

“Range brings them in the door,” Fisch said of prospective customers. “The ability to customize the sensor to their use case is what’s sealing the deal.”

He said the company’s long-range Apollo sensor previously offered one kilometer of range, while its newer Stratos sensor has a range of 1.5 kilometers and fits in the palm of a hand. AEye can alter certain optics and remove logic for applications that require narrower viewing angles and longer-range sensing, Fisch said, adding that more than 90% of the work between Apollo and Stratos is shared, primarily through software.

Potential automotive applications vary by vehicle type, executives said. Robotaxis may require detailed sensing around the vehicle while also needing longer-distance visibility for highway driving. Trucks may prioritize a narrower field of view and extended range due to long braking distances. Passenger vehicles may use a long-range sensor behind the windshield, which Fisch said can provide packaging advantages compared with roof-mounted systems.

Fisch also highlighted the sensor’s durability, saying AEye’s MEMS-based architecture uses a moving part about one millimeter in size. He said the company recently tested the technology for a customer requiring 1,000g shock resilience.

Manufacturing and automotive economics

Fisch said supply-chain resilience has become a “table stakes” requirement among purchasing departments at automakers and other transportation customers. AEye manufactures in North America through a global and flexible supply-chain footprint, he said.

The company’s current production line, announced late last year, is prepared to ramp to 60,000 units annually, according to Fisch. He said AEye’s modular assembly and supply-chain model allows it to scale manufacturing up or down while limiting the need for significant upfront investment in production lines.

AEye also pointed to its relationship with NVIDIA as a way to reduce software integration costs for customers. Fisch said NVIDIA’s hardware is deployed or stated to be used by more than 35 original equipment manufacturers, making compatibility with its platform valuable when approaching automotive customers.

Conor Tierney, AEye’s chief financial officer, said automotive LiDAR pricing at volume is expected to be below $1,000 per unit. He said initial samples can command higher prices, while non-automotive applications can involve prices in the tens of thousands of dollars when hardware, software and services are included.

  • Automotive applications generally face more compressed margins, Tierney said.
  • High-performance aerospace and defense applications can support margins above 60%, according to Tierney.
  • AEye expects licensing relationships with Tier 1 suppliers to become more relevant for higher-volume automotive programs over the longer term.

Defense and security opportunities

Fisch said defense represented the largest portion of AEye’s revenue during the first half of the year, driven by demand related to unmanned ground vehicles, drones, manned vehicles and counter-unmanned aircraft systems.

He said long-range LiDAR can help larger drones identify hazards such as power lines during low-altitude missions. According to Fisch, the technology can detect power lines about three centimeters thick from hundreds of meters away. He also described counter-drone applications in which LiDAR can complement radar by providing finer resolution and helping distinguish drones from other objects.

For larger combat or surveillance drones, Fisch said the Stratos sensor weighs about one kilogram and consumes roughly 15 to 18 watts of power. He said defense-oriented sensors can sell for thousands of dollars, and in some cases above $10,000, compared with automotive price expectations generally ranging from $500 to $1,000.

The company also cited security applications, including data centers, border security and perimeter monitoring. Fisch said AEye works with partner Flasheye on perception applications that can distinguish humans, animals and other sources of potential false alarms. Tierney added that LiDAR can offer advantages in areas such as chain-link-fence monitoring, where radar may experience interference.

Fisch said AEye has 25 revenue-generating customers, a strong cash position and what he described as a clean balance sheet. Tierney said the company intends to maintain its capital-light operating model, although management would evaluate investment needs if a major growth opportunity emerged.
